SHE FORGOT THER MANNERS AND GOT THE VOTE--THE PIONEERING LIFE OF ABIGAIL SCOTT DUNIWAY
Let's face it, even some of us who were born and raised in Portland weren't taught anything about the woman that Portland's Duniway Park and Duniway Elementary School were named after. I grew up a mile from Duniway Elementary and knew very little about the Oregon Trail pioneer and suffragist until our son Drew attended Duniway in the early 2000s. My mission is to ensure that this is not the case for the next generation of Oregonians!
